"On my way JLo" is an online phrase that blends a common status update with the name of the singer and actress Jennifer Lopez. The expression is used to signal movement toward a destination or event while playfully invoking the celebrity's persona for tone or humor. Literal Meaning and Core Usage
At face value, "on my way JLo" combines a standard progress statement with a proper name. In practice, it functions as a stylized way to communicate imminent arrival or action. The phrase is conversational, informal, and most often found in brief, real-time messages such as social media replies, story updates, or chat texts. By attaching a recognizable celebrity name, the speaker adds personality or a sense of urgency to a mundane update.
Structure and Grammar Patterns
The construction follows a familiar template in which a public figure's name is appended to a routine disclosure. Similar patterns exist with other celebrities, but the durability and recognizability of Jennifer Lopez have made her name a consistent choice. The phrase is not typically used as a direct quote from Lopez or her media, but rather as a shorthand device that leverages her broad cultural presence to add flair or emphasis to a simple status update.

Origins and Spread on Social Platforms
While it is difficult to trace a single origin point, the phrase gained traction on platforms where users frequently blend humor, brevity, and pop culture references. Its spread reflects an internet habit of grafting recognizable names onto everyday statements to make them more engaging. Memes, caption templates, and short-form videos have all helped normalize such constructions, allowing them to enter common usage quickly and often without a single definitive source.
Online Usage and Communicative Function
Everyday Contexts
In everyday usage, "on my way JLo" works as a succinct reply to check-ins about location or timing. It softens the request for urgency without sounding demanding. For example, in group chats or event coordination, the phrase can acknowledge a pending arrival while injecting a moment of personality into an otherwise transactional exchange.
Social Media and Content Creation
On social media, the phrase can serve as a caption or status update, particularly when posting about travel, event attendance, or meetups. Influencers and casual users alike may deploy it for stylistic consistency, leveraging the familiarity of the name to add rhythm or humor. Sometimes it is used ironically, playing off the contrast between a grand celebrity reference and an ordinary situation.
Tone and Register
The tone of "on my way JLo" is generally light, casual, and humorous. Because it references a major celebrity in a non-literal way, it is rarely interpreted as a factual statement about the artist herself. Instead, the phrase operates as a pop-cultural seasoning that enlivens otherwise plain updates without requiring extensive explanation.

Misinterpretations and Common Queries
Because the phrase incorporates a proper name, some new users may ask whether it is an official quote from Jennifer Lopez or tied to a specific project. It is best understood as an independently created mashup rather than a licensed reference. Additionally, the phrase is not inherently romantic or romanticized; its meaning centers on movement and timing, with the celebrity name serving primarily as a stylistic anchor.
